In the clinic, we often encounter some elderly patients, especially elderly female patients, when they come to the hospital, even they can not say exactly where they do not feel well. If you ask about headache, you say you have headache, if you ask about dizziness, you say you have dizziness, if you ask about panic, you say you have panic, if you ask about insomnia, you say you have insomnia ……. Anyway, as long as the doctor asked about the symptoms he (she) almost all exist, but the laboratory tests to do a whole lot, various hospitals turned a whole lot, is what the problem did not find. Many family members think that they are not sick and pretend to be sick, or think that there is a mental problem, what is this? In fact, this is a disease, but it is not familiar to people. The medical term for these symptoms is indeterminate statements, which have multiple complaints of generalized lethargy, fatigue, headache, palpitations, sleep disorders, gastrointestinal malfunction, etc., but no corresponding lesions. The group of symptoms of these indeterminate statements is called indeterminate statement syndrome. Patients and their family members are often exhausted and suffer from this, and they are always running around between large and small hospitals, and taking a lot of Chinese and Western medicines to no avail. According to statistics, 36% of patients have insomnia, dizziness, body aches, headache, weakness of legs; 23% of patients have stomach pain, nausea, loss of appetite, indigestion, bloating, diarrhea, constipation; 22% of patients have panic, shortness of breath, weakness; 18% of patients have general fatigue, low fever, sweating, irritability, irritability, forgetfulness and so on. This disease can be divided into three categories: First, the neurological type, mainly psychological disorders, manifested as insomnia, irritability, irritability, paranoia, crying, etc.. The second is the autonomic dysfunction type, with autonomic dysfunction as the main manifestation, such as panic, sweating, general weakness, loss of appetite, etc. The third is the psychosomatic type, which has both the above two symptoms. The treatment of indeterminate statement syndrome should adopt comprehensive therapy. One of the most advanced, effective and commonly used methods is the stellate ganglion block. The stellate ganglion is a sympathetic ganglion located in front of the transverse processes of the sixth and seventh cervical vertebrae in the neck, and the indeterminate presentation syndrome is mainly caused by sympathetic hyperfunction and parasympathetic hypofunction. Therefore, blocking the stellate ganglion can regulate the functional state of the vegetative nerves, thus achieving the purpose of treatment. The stellate ganglion block has the advantages of quick effect, precise efficacy, safety, less toxic side effects and wide indications, which is widely used in clinical treatment in many countries in the world, especially in Japan. However, the stellate ganglion block is injected in the neck, which is rich in local neurovascularity and close to the spinal canal. Once improperly performed, it can lead to complications such as inadvertent entry into the blood vessels causing toxic reactions, injury to the lung tip leading to pneumothorax, and inadvertent entry into the spinal canal causing respiratory and circulatory depression. In case of laryngeal nerve block, it can lead to hoarseness. Therefore, it must be operated by an experienced pain physician or anesthesiologist, and the treatment must also be performed under medical conditions with certain monitoring and resuscitation, which may limit the development and clinical application of this method to some extent. Other treatment methods include linear polarized light near-infrared neck irradiation, adjuvant therapy with Valium and vitamin drugs, Chinese herbal medicine, Chinese acupuncture, and psychotherapy.
